Output e57b59df875a61746ae06f494c8cf6f5d46acbc2c9aca720f743ba57d33fdb13:1

value
13895781
script pubkey
OP_0 OP_PUSHBYTES_32 cebd498f56bdc89c51c67a6aa81295d57994a4506baa39ebd564065819256412
address
bc1qe675nr6khhyfc5wx0f42sy5464ueffzsdw4rn674vsr9sxf9vsfqh33lru
transaction
e57b59df875a61746ae06f494c8cf6f5d46acbc2c9aca720f743ba57d33fdb13
confirmations
33618
spent
true